How to view an HTML file in the browser with Visual Studio Code
Mar 3, 2017 · Switch back to your html file (in this example it's "text.html"), and press ctrl + shift + b to view your page in your Web Browser. You can even use variables if you have more than one HTML file. You can do: "args": [" {$file}"] to pass the current open file. See also code.visualstudio.com/Docs/tasks#_variables-in-tasksjson.
